A casual handwritten print with a consistent, monoline stroke and softly rounded terminals. The letters show a gentle rightward slant and a lively, slightly uneven rhythm that mimics quick marker or brush-pen writing. Curves are open and smooth, bowls are compact, and joins are kept simple rather than calligraphic. Capitals are tall and straightforward, while lowercase forms stay compact with short extenders and minimal ornament, giving the face a tidy but informal texture.

Well-suited to short display copy where a friendly, handcrafted voice is desired—such as packaging, café menus, greeting cards, posters, and social media graphics. It can also work for headings and callouts in educational or lifestyle materials where an informal, human tone is more important than strict typographic regularity.

The overall tone is warm and personable, with a spontaneous, sketchbook energy. Small irregularities in stroke direction and spacing keep it from feeling mechanical, which reads as authentic and conversational. It feels playful and easygoing rather than formal or strict.

The design appears intended to capture the look of neat, quick hand-printing with a light slant and consistent pen width. It prioritizes approachability and a natural written rhythm while keeping letterforms simple enough for clear reading in headline and short-text contexts.

Round letters (like O, C, e) appear slightly oval and loosely drawn, and several glyphs show subtle stroke taper or pressure shifts without strong contrast. Numerals match the handwritten feel, with simple shapes and open counters that keep them readable in casual settings. Spacing looks naturally variable, contributing to the handwritten cadence in longer text.
